A BESS cabinet is a self-contained unit that houses battery modules, power conversion systems, and control electronics. It is designed to store electrical energy and release it when needed, providing a reliable and scalable solution for energy storage. ade in a variety of energy storage technologies. Eritrea advanced energy storage project

Eritrea advanced energy storage project

Located near the town of Dekemhare, approximately 40km southeast of the capital, Asmara, the ambitious project encompasses a 30MW solar photovoltaic power station coupled with a 15MW/30MWh energy storage system.
